Setting the Scene: What to Expect from the Tour
This tour begins early at around 8:00 AM with a pick-up from your hotel or railway station in Agra. The journey is in a private, air-conditioned vehicle—crucial for comfort in the sometimes sweltering Indian heat—and includes shoes covers to preserve the monument’s pristine marble.
By 8:30 AM, you’re at the gates of the Taj Mahal, ready for your skip-the-line entry. This advantage is a significant time-saver, especially during peak tourist seasons when queues can stretch long. Your guide, who is both friendly and well-informed—according to reviews—will lead you through the marble masterpiece, explaining the intricate craftsmanship, the symbolism of the gardens, and the romantic story behind Shah Jahan and Mumtaz Mahal.
The Taj Mahal Experience
Once inside, you’ll appreciate the symmetry and delicate carvings that make the Taj a marvel of Mughal architecture. The main dome, surrounded by four minarets, is a sight to behold—photos here are a must. The guide often takes pictures for you, which is a thoughtful touch, and the timing around the reflecting pools offers perfect photo opportunities.
For those who opt for the Mausoleum interior upgrade, you’ll step inside to see the inner chamber and cenotaphs, gaining a deeper understanding of its function as a tomb. While this part might be optional or an extra fee, it provides a unique perspective on the monument’s purpose.

At booking, you can choose additional experiences like visiting Agra Fort, a UNESCO-listed red sandstone fortress that served as the Mughal residence, or enjoying a sunset view from Mehtab Bagh, which offers a serene perspective of the Taj across the river.
There’s also an opportunity to see a marble inlay workshop, where artisans demonstrate the traditional craftsmanship seen in the Taj. These add-ons can make the visit more comprehensive, especially if you’re interested in Mughal architecture or local arts.

FAQ

Is transportation included? Yes, the tour provides private, air-conditioned transportation for pickup and drop-off in Agra, Delhi, or Jaipur depending on your booking.
Can I skip the optional mausoleum interior? Absolutely. The main tour covers the exterior and gardens, and the interior can be added at an extra cost or skipped if you prefer.
What is the guide’s role during the tour? Your licensed guide will lead you through the monument, share stories and details, assist with photographs, and answer questions, making the experience more engaging.
Are shoes covers provided? Yes, shoes covers are included to help keep the monument clean.
How flexible is the schedule? The tour starts early and ends around noon, with optional add-ons available. You can customize your visit when booking.
Is this tour suitable for families? It is suitable for most travelers, but those with mobility issues should consider the physical demands of walking around the monument.
What languages are offered? Tours are available in English, French, German, Japanese, Russian, and Spanish.
